------------------------------------------------------------
revno: 887
committer: Roger Martin <[email protected]>
branch nick: aikiframework
timestamp: Tue 2011-07-19 22:24:25 +0200
message:
only active user can login
modified:
src/libs/membership.php
src/sql/CreateTables.sql
src/sql/InsertVariable-in.sql
--
lp:aikiframework
https://code.launchpad.net/~aikiframework-devel/aikiframework/trunk
Your team Aiki Framework Developers is subscribed to branch lp:aikiframework.
To unsubscribe from this branch go to
https://code.launchpad.net/~aikiframework-devel/aikiframework/trunk/+edit-subscription
=== modified file 'src/libs/membership.php'
--- src/libs/membership.php 2011-07-06 21:03:32 +0000
+++ src/libs/membership.php 2011-07-19 20:24:25 +0000
@@ -171,7 +171,12 @@
session_start();
}
- $get_user = $db->get_row("SELECT * FROM aiki_users WHERE username='$username' AND password='$password' LIMIT 1");
+ $get_user = $db->get_row(
+ "SELECT * FROM aiki_users".
+ " WHERE username='$username' ".
+ " AND password='$password' ".
+ " AND is_active=1" .
+ " LIMIT 1");
if($get_user){
$host_name = $_SERVER['HTTP_HOST'];
$user_ip = $this->get_ip();
=== modified file 'src/sql/CreateTables.sql'
--- src/sql/CreateTables.sql 2011-07-14 21:06:10 +0000
+++ src/sql/CreateTables.sql 2011-07-19 20:24:25 +0000
@@ -183,7 +183,7 @@
maillist int(1) NOT NULL,
logins_number int(11) NOT NULL,
randkey varchar(255) NOT NULL,
- is_active int(5) NOT NULL,
+ is_active int(5) NOT NULL default '1',
PRIMARY KEY (userid),
UNIQUE KEY username (username)
) ENGINE=MyISAM CHARSET=utf8;
=== modified file 'src/sql/InsertVariable-in.sql'
--- src/sql/InsertVariable-in.sql 2011-07-07 04:47:33 +0000
+++ src/sql/InsertVariable-in.sql 2011-07-19 20:24:25 +0000
@@ -35,8 +35,8 @@
-- ------------------------------------------------------
INSERT IGNORE INTO `aiki_users` (`userid`, `username`, `full_name`, `country`, `sex`, `job`, `password`, `usergroup`, `email`, `avatar`, `homepage`, `first_ip`, `first_login`, `last_login`, `last_ip`, `user_permissions`, `maillist`, `logins_number`, `randkey`, `is_active`) VALUES
-(1, 'guest', 'guest', '', '', '', '', 3, '', '', '', '', '0000-00-00 00:00:00', '0000-00-00 00:00:00', '', '', 0, 0, '', 0),
-(2, '@ADMIN_USER@', '@ADMIN_NAME@', '', '', '', '@ADMIN_PASS@', 1, '@ADMIN_MAIL@', '', '', '', '', '', '', '', 0, 0, '', 0);
+(1, 'guest', 'guest', '', '', '', '', 3, '', '', '', '', '0000-00-00 00:00:00', '0000-00-00 00:00:00', '', '', 0, 0, '', 1),
+(2, '@ADMIN_USER@', '@ADMIN_NAME@', '', '', '', '@ADMIN_PASS@', 1, '@ADMIN_MAIL@', '', '', '', '', '', '', '', 0, 0, '', 1);
-- ------------------------------------------------------
_______________________________________________
Mailing list: https://launchpad.net/~aikiframework-devel
Post to : [email protected]
Unsubscribe : https://launchpad.net/~aikiframework-devel
More help : https://help.launchpad.net/ListHelp